    Doing resort only trip, no parks. Will do topolino breakfast, but what other things can we do that give Disney experience without parks. Two kids 6, 2. Staying at AoA.

    To begin with, I love that you've snagged a breakfast reservation at Topolino's Terrace. It's one of my favorite character dining experiences, and the food is absolutely delicious! After your meal, be sure to step out onto the terrace, where you'll be treated to breathtaking views where you can actually spot all four theme parks! While you're there, I highly recommend taking some time to stroll around Riviera Resort. The beautifully detailed murals throughout the resort are absolutely stunning and make for perfect photo opportunities.

    Staying at Art of Animation is a fantastic choice. One of the biggest perks is its location right on the Disney Skyliner route. I'd definitely suggest taking advantage of this by doing a little resort hopping. From Art of Animation, you can glide over to Riviera and continue on to Caribbean Beach Resort. You can also head to the EPCOT area to visit Beach Club, Yacht Club, and Boardwalk, all of which are fun to explore and each offers unique theming. While you're in that area, you could even walk over to the Swan Hotel for a fun round of putt-putt at Fantasia Mini Golf

    Another great idea is to set aside a full day to explore Disney Springs. There's so much to see and do, from shopping and dining to live entertainment. Your little ones will love hopping on the carousel and train ride located in the Marketplace, which is a great way to add some playful Disney magic to your day.

    And when you're back at your home resort, don't miss time at the Big Blue Pool. Inspired by Finding Nemo, it's not only beautifully themed, but it also holds the title of being the largest pool on all of Walt Disney World property...perfect for relaxing or letting the kids splash and play.

    Finally, be sure to check your resort's daily activity schedule during your stay. Disney Resorts offer a variety of fun experiences, including campfire activities, crafts, Movies Under the Stars, and more.
